titleOfInvention | Permanent magnet motor rotor structure for enhancing shielding effect of harmonic magnetic field |
abstract | The utility model discloses a permanent magnet motor rotor structure for enhancing the shielding effect of a harmonic magnetic field, which comprises a rotating shaft and is characterized in that the surface of the rotating shaft is wrapped with a rotor core, a permanent magnet, a shielding layer and a rotor sheath from inside to outside in sequence; and the two axial ends of the permanent magnet are provided with conductive end covers, and the conductive end covers are fixedly connected with the shielding layer and are tightly attached to the permanent magnet. The structure can effectively reduce the eddy current loss in the permanent magnet and the eddy current loss in the shielding layer, reduce the total eddy current loss of the rotor and improve the operation reliability of the permanent magnet motor. |
